If I book a disney resort like GF for a couple nights before my stay at AKLV, using my points, can I get the dining plan, and do I have to get the one day ticket to get the dining plan.(sorry be question mark key doesn`t seem to work) Does booking a disney resort with points work the sames as booking a vacation club resort. Would I pay for the dining plan at checkin like I would do at a vacation club resort. I have double developer points and looking at ways to kind of waste them. lol. GF would take alot of the points.
 
I might be wrong. But, I don't believe booking the Disney collection with points is eligible for the dining plan at all. Iknow I've seen this come up before and I don't recall the rationale behind it. Let's see if someone else has more and better info. :surfweb:
 
DVC negotiated the right for members to purchase the Disney Dining Plan when they stay on points at DVC resorts. They did not negotiate that right for members using points in other ways. So if you want the DDP for a stay at the GF, you'll have to pay rack rate and purchase a ticket as part of the package.
 
CapeCod Family is correct. Members who book one of the non-DVC WDW resorts using points cannot add the Dining Plan to the reservation.

The only way to get the Dining Plan at the GF (or any other non-DVC resort) is to purchase a package for cash through CRO/WDWTC. That means a minimum stay, paying rack rates for lodging and buying at least a one day base ticket.
